Hello all, I have filled up the water tank for the sink tonight (with cleaner) I was expecting the water to come back out thewater filler cap when full. BUT the water came out of the water tank almost as if there was an overfill pipe??? Is that so or do i have a leak?? also the water meter does not work and the set button.... although i am confused how to operate both. is there a seperate fuse for that meter??

thanks for help, i have a 1991 vw transporter, trooper auto sleeper.... thanks

Welcome.

Is it not possible to see where the water is coming out from underneath? Poss split in the tank??? perished hose?? Gonna have to get under there. Remove tank and refill to find the leak. If its anything like our 1986 autosleeper then its just a couple of brackets to remove to get tank out.

leesoya wrote:Hello all, I have filled up the water tank for the sink tonight (with cleaner) I was expecting the water to come back out thewater filler cap when full. BUT the water came out of the water tank almost as if there was an overfill pipe??? Is that so or do i have a leak??

mine does it's an overflow

leesoya wrote: also the water meter does not work and the set button.... although i am confused how to operate both. is there a seperate fuse for that meter??



leigh

set button???

the sender is a resistance type with no fuse.
remove the unit and scrape off the limescale it should work then
first check the wiring is in good order and power is at the test button by removing the control panel
